Showing 949–960 of 1895 results

$38.87$46.00
$34.50$52.90
$34.50$52.90
Sale!
$32.90$40.90
$34.50$52.90
Sale!
$37.95$44.85
$34.50$52.90
Sale!
$14.84$24.15